Indie rock music on the radio

Indie rock music is a genre that emerged in the 1980s and became popular in the 1990s. It is characterized by a DIY (do it yourself) approach, and its artists are often unsigned or signed to independent record labels. Indie rock is also known for its diversity and experimentation, with influences from punk, folk, and alternative rock.

Some of the most popular indie rock artists include Radiohead, Arcade Fire, The Strokes, Arctic Monkeys, and The White Stripes. Radiohead is a British band known for their experimental sound and political themes. Arcade Fire, from Canada, has won multiple Grammy awards for their blend of indie rock and orchestral arrangements. The Strokes, from New York City, gained popularity in the early 2000s with their garage rock sound. Arctic Monkeys, from England, are known for their witty lyrics and catchy hooks. The White Stripes, a duo from Detroit, are known for their raw and stripped-down sound.

There are several radio stations that specialize in indie rock music. Some of the most popular ones include KEXP (Seattle), KCRW (Los Angeles), and WXPN (Philadelphia). KEXP is known for its live performances and diverse range of indie rock music, while KCRW is known for its eclectic mix of indie rock, electronic, and world music. WXPN is home to the popular radio show “World Cafe,” which features interviews and live performances from indie rock artists.
